
To maximize the lifespan of an electric vehicle (EV) battery, follow these best practices based on expert guidance and studies:
Maintain a Moderate State of Charge (20-80% Rule)
- Avoid charging your battery fully to 100% regularly. Most manufacturers and experts recommend limiting the charge to around 80% to reduce stress and degradation on the battery cells.
- Similarly, avoid letting the battery level drop below about 20%. Deep discharges can strain the battery and accelerate capacity loss.
- This 20-80% charging window is especially important if you do not drive the EV frequently or if planning long-term storage.
Charge Regularly
- Instead of waiting for the battery to be nearly empty, charge it regularly to keep the battery in the optimal charge range.
- Regular charging helps prevent deep discharges, which are detrimental to battery health.
Use Appropriate Charging Levels
- Prefer Level 1 (standard household outlet) or Level 2 (240V faster home charger) charging for daily use, as these maintain the battery temperature better and reduce stress.
- Avoid frequent use of Level 3 fast charging (supercharging) because high current rates generate extra heat, which can hasten degradation.
- However, real-world tests show that occasional fast charging has only a minor effect on battery capacity over time.
Avoid Extreme Temperatures
- Heat above roughly 86°F (30°C) and cold below 32°F (0°C) can damage lithium-ion batteries.
- Whenever possible, park your EV in a garage or shaded spot to protect the battery from temperature extremes.
Other Practical Tips
- Do not leave your EV plugged in after it reaches full charge, especially with older charging systems that may not have advanced controls.
- If storing the EV for a long time, recharge it to about 80% at least once every few months to avoid damage from a fully depleted battery.
- Optimize preconditioning and balanced charging if your vehicle offers these features, to further protect battery health.
By following these practices—keeping the battery charge mostly between 20% and 80%, charging regularly with moderate-speed chargers, avoiding extreme temperatures, and minimizing fast charging use—you ensure your EV battery maintains capacity and performance for as long as possible. This leads to better driving range, performance, and resale value over the lifetime of the vehicle.
